Offload functions to worker threads with shared memory primitives for Node.js.
1import { registerSync } from './reconstruct.ts';
2
3export class Int32Atomic {
4 static readonly byteSize = 4;
5 static readonly byteAlignment = 4;
6 private readonly view: Int32Array;
7
8 constructor(buffer?: SharedArrayBuffer, byteOffset?: number) {
9 const buf = buffer ?? new SharedArrayBuffer(4);
10 const offset = byteOffset ?? 0;
11 this.view = new Int32Array(buf, offset, 1);
12 }
13
14 load(): number {
15 return Atomics.load(this.view, 0);
16 }
17
18 store(value: number): void {
19 Atomics.store(this.view, 0, value);
20 }
21
22 add(value: number): number {
23 return Atomics.add(this.view, 0, value);
24 }
25
26 sub(value: number): number {
27 return Atomics.sub(this.view, 0, value);
28 }
29
30 and(value: number): number {
31 return Atomics.and(this.view, 0, value);
32 }
33
34 or(value: number): number {
35 return Atomics.or(this.view, 0, value);
36 }
37
38 xor(value: number): number {
39 return Atomics.xor(this.view, 0, value);
40 }
41
42 exchange(value: number): number {
43 return Atomics.exchange(this.view, 0, value);
44 }
45
46 compareExchange(expected: number, replacement: number): number {
47 return Atomics.compareExchange(this.view, 0, expected, replacement);
48 }
49
50 [Symbol.for('moroutine.shared')](): { tag: string; buffer: SharedArrayBuffer; byteOffset: number } {
51 return { tag: 'Int32Atomic', buffer: this.view.buffer as SharedArrayBuffer, byteOffset: this.view.byteOffset };
52 }
53}
54
55registerSync('Int32Atomic', Int32Atomic);
